Gypsum is a soft sulfate mineral composed of calcium sulfate dehydrate, with the chemical formula CaSO. 4· 2H2O Gypsum is widely used in construction because of its ability to hold nails, screws and other small parts. Some gypsum products are used to make drywall, plaster foundation and facing materials, concrete and stucco. Chemical Specifications: CaSO. 4· 2H2O 95-98%
